Warning Signs You Need Insulation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show moisture buildup in your insulation. Don’t ignore it, call our team to inspect and restore your insulation.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Visible water stains can be a sign of underlying water damage. Our team will inspect and repair any damage to ensure your home remains safe and secure.

Mold Growth or Black Spots

Mold growth can spread quickly, causing health risks and structural issues. Our team will remove mold and restore your insulation to its original condition.

Increased Energy Bills

Water-damaged insulation can lead to increased energy bills. Our team will inspect and restore your insulation to ensure your home remains energy-efficient.

Insulation Water Damage Restoration Cost in Talala, OK

The cost of insulation water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Talala, OK. Our team will provide a detailed estimate of the work to be done, including any necessary repairs or replacements.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Insulation Inspection and Assessment $100-$500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Water Removal and Drying $500-$2,500 Amount of water, type of insulation
Insulation Replacement $1,000-$5,000 Size of affected area, type of insulation
Final Inspection and Testing $100-$500 Complexity of damage, type of insulation
Emergency Service Fee $100-$500 Time of day, urgency of situation

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with you to develop a customized plan to restore your insulation and ensure your home remains safe and secure.
